About Michael Ram

Michael Ram heads Morgan & Morgan's consumer products and automotive litigation department, drawing on four decades of consumer class action work. A cum laude graduate of Harvard Law School (1982), he shared the Trial Lawyer of the Year Award from Trial Lawyers for Public Justice in 1992 for National Association of Radiation Survivors v. Walters, litigated major class actions at Lieff Cabraser from 1993 to 1997, and then founded his own San Francisco firm. His co-lead counsel roles have included the Lumber Liquidators bamboo flooring class action, a $30 million Wells Fargo interest-charge settlement, and a certified ADA class of wheelchair users against Lyft.
